Opening of 20 new working places in Peltina Ltd.

The project proposal includes the opening of 20 newjobs in Peltina Ltd. - town of Iskar, related with the expansion of the scale of production, purchase of the equipment which is necessary to carry out the work process, appointment of unemployed and/or inactive individuals from target groups in the newly created company working positions and provide relevant educational training for the positions: - 20 persons for worker canning of fruits / vegetables. The project will be realized through implementation of the activities described: Activity 1 - Organization and Project Management; Activity 2 - Recruitment of unemployed and/or inactive for a period of 12 months; Activity 3 - Provision of vocational training for acquiring professional qualification of newly appointed persons; Activity 4 - Purchase of equipment and furniture associated with the creation of jobs; Activity 5 - Implementation of measures to visualization and communication; This project contributes to creating conditions for permanent employment of unemployed persons who fall within the priority target groups of the program. The project is aimed at the integration of some of the most vulnerable groups in the labor market. The project implementation will contribute to the realization of the main challenges set in OPHRD - higher and quality employment, reducing poverty and promote social inclusion, the modernization of public policies through networking and partnerships with business, acquire skills, possibility of lifelong learning and improving the adaptability of the employees and the quality of the jobs.
